AI Does Not Eliminate the Need for Software Engineering

AI increases the need for coherent architecture, engineering discipline, and measurable operational accountability.

Artificial intelligence is changing how software is conceived, designed, implemented, tested, operated, and improved. Its impact will be comparable to earlier shifts toward distributed systems, the internet, cloud computing, and mobile platforms.

But AI does not eliminate the need for software engineering. It increases it.

Faster code generation creates value only when the resulting systems remain architecturally coherent, secure, testable, maintainable, observable, and aligned with business objectives.
